// nbReducedCoordinates = smallest power of 2 which is above nbValues
uint32_t nbReducedCoordinates = (uint32_t)ceil(log2(nbValues));
- Real* reducedCoordinates = (Real*) malloc(nbSeries * nbReducedCoordinates * sizeof(Real));
+ float* reducedCoordinates = (float*) malloc(nbSeries * nbReducedCoordinates * sizeof(float));
// call preprocessing with the rows of raw power values matrix.
// Keep the IDs in memory for further processing.
// *** Step 2 ***
// Run PAM algorithm on the dissimilarity matrix computed from 'reducedCoordinates'.
- Real* dissimilarities = get_dissimilarities_intra(
+ float* dissimilarities = get_dissimilarities_intra(
reducedCoordinates, nbSeries, nbReducedCoordinates, work->p_for_dissims);
free(reducedCoordinates);